首页
外语
计算机
考研
公务员
职业资格
财经
工程
司法
医学
专升本
自考
实用职业技能
登录
计算机
有如下程序: #include using namespace std; class A{ public: A(){cout
有如下程序: #include using namespace std; class A{ public: A(){cout
admin
2015-09-14
19
问题
有如下程序:
#include
using namespace std;
class A{
public:
A(){cout<<’A’;}
~A(){cout<<一’C’;}
};
class B:public A{
public:
B(){cout<<’G’;}
~BO{cout<<’T’;}
};
int main(){
B obj;
return 0;
}
运行这个程序的输出结果是( )。
选项
A、GATC
B、AGTC
C、GACT
D、AGCT
答案
B
解析
派生类B是由基类A公开继承而来,所以在创建类B的obj对象时,首先执行基类A的构造函数A(),输出A,再执行派生类B的构造函数B(),输出G,当程序结束时,首先执行派生类的析构函数~B(),输出T,再执行基类A的析构函数~A(),输出C。
转载请注明原文地址:https://jikaoti.com/ti/E4E0FFFM
本试题收录于:
二级C题库NCRE全国计算机二级分类
0
二级C
NCRE全国计算机二级
相关试题推荐
执行下列程序段,结果是#include<iostream.h>voidmain(){intx=40;chary=’C’;intn;
以下程序的输出结果是#include<iostream.h>voidmain(){inti,j,x=0;for(i=0;i<2;i++){x++;
有如下程序#include<iostream.h>voidmain(){charch[2][5]={"6937","8254"},*p[2];inti,j,s=0;
对表达式for(表达式1;;表达式3)可理解为
在进行任何C++流的操作后,都可以用C++流的有关成员函数检测流的状态;其中只能用于检测输入流状态的操作函数名称是
有以下程序#include<iostream>usingnamespacestd;classsample{private:intx;public:sample(intA
若要定义一个只允许本源文件中所有函数使用的全局变量,则该变量需“要使用的存储类别是()。
软件开发环境是全面支持软件开发全过程的【】集合。
经常和一个运算符连用,构成一个运算符函数名的C++关键词是【】。
C++流中重载了运算符<<,它是一个()。
随机试题
不属于继发性高血压的是
中央银行的产生一般______商业银行。
患者,女,25岁,结婚2年,未孕,闭经4个月,泌乳,体重较前增加。为进一步明确诊断,以下检查最有意义的是
下列内容中,属于工程质量事故报告的有()。
施工环境因素的控制的主要内容包括()。
在实践中,针对不同职业的客户应当选择不同的筹资方法。较为适合生意人的筹资方法有()①薪酬比例法;②固定供款额法;③储蓄法;④趸缴法
某A股上市公司,2016年12月5日宣告实行年度分红,每股派发现金红利(税前)人民币0.15元。该上市公司股东部分情况如下:国内甲企业2015年12月9日成为该上市公司股东;国内张三先生2015年11月8日成为该上市公司股东;某未在境内设立机构的合格境外机
一些贫困地区之所以贫困,除了地理______、生存环境恶劣,其实背后也存在______的贫困。这种贫困既包括不能______地享受社保、教育、公共设施等,也包括土地、财产权益的诸多限制。填入画横线部分最恰当的一项是:
要限制宏命令的操作范围,可以在创建宏时定义()。
CAVIL:CRITICIZE::
最新回复
(
0
)